Output cca77966d6d94145424cec951096f1aa9a29f642e090009b29f55b541d801a4a:0

value
3013769
script pubkey
OP_0 OP_PUSHBYTES_20 60001aa9834cc4ce5a0ca3403355797bbeb9639a
address
bc1qvqqp42vrfnzvuksv5dqrx4te0wltjcu6pqgz8t
transaction
cca77966d6d94145424cec951096f1aa9a29f642e090009b29f55b541d801a4a
confirmations
76072
spent
true